Toothache pain for anyone in Carrollton can be unbearable. At the very least, tooth pain can cause you to avoid eating certain foods, certain temperatures, and even talking. Severe toothaches can be downright debilitating, forcing patients to go to extreme measures to alleviate the pain.

Around Carrollton, the most common causes of a toothache include tooth infection, decay, injury, and loss of a tooth. Tooth pain can also occur after a tooth has been extracted, or after an oral surgery involving anything from a tooth or your jawbone.
